Why might a woman have overly large breasts?

There are many reasons why a woman may have large breasts, but one of the main factors is genetics. Breast size can therefore be a result of inheritance. Additionally, hormonal changes during puberty, pregnancy, and menopause can also affect breast size.

What problems can large breasts cause?

Unfortunately, large breasts can cause various problems. Performing simple activities such as running or lifting objects can often be very difficult. The strain caused by the weight of large breasts leads to back and neck pain as well as numerous tensions in the shoulders. Finding a properly fitting bra can also be very challenging.

What does the procedure involve?

The mammoplasty procedure, or breast reduction, involves surgically reducing the volume of the breasts while simultaneously changing their shape, lifting the breasts, and repositioning the nipple-areola complex.

When is the procedure performed?

Breast reduction is performed for both health and aesthetic reasons.

Large, disproportionate breasts often cause discomfort for the patient, hinder daily activities, and also lead to posture defects. In women suffering from gigantomastia, one breast can weigh even 2.5 to 3 kg, while a normally sized breast weighs about 0.5 kg. The skin and chest muscles cannot support such weight, resulting in significant strain on the spine.

Indications for performing mammoplasty

Indications for performing mammoplasty may include:

1

the need to adjust breast size to body shape

2

complexes and discomfort due to large breasts

3

problems during daily activities and functioning (e.g., related to purchasing clothing, mobility)

4

asymmetry (one breast significantly larger than the other)

5

neck and back pain and numbness in the upper limbs

6

degenerative spine disease

7

chronic headaches

8

grooves/pressure sores from bra straps; chafing, skin maceration, rashes, and inflammatory skin conditions in the inframammary folds

Results of Mammoplasty Procedure

The breast reduction effect is long-lasting and visible immediately after the procedure. After the swelling subsides, the breast will take its final shape and size in about 6 months.

What is the recovery like after breast reduction surgery?
After the surgery, the patient stays in the hospital for 1 day. During this time, pain medications are administered. Immediately after the surgery, a special bra is applied to properly support and shape the final appearance of the breasts. The bra should then be worn by the patient around the clock for one month. Swelling persists for about 2 weeks after the surgery. Stitches are removed approximately 7-14 days after the procedure. Sensation in the nipple area may be reduced or absent in the case of an inverted “T” incision. Physical activity is contraindicated during recovery. Normal activities can be resumed after one month. If any pain occurs, the patient should report it to their doctor. The breast reduction effect is long-lasting and visible immediately after the procedure. After the swelling subsides, the breast will take its final shape and size after about 6 months.
What are the contraindications for breast reduction surgery?
Breast reduction is not performed on pregnant or breastfeeding women. Contraindications also include cancer, uncontrolled diabetes, hypertension, and blood clotting disorders.
How to prepare for the procedure?
A consultation with a plastic surgeon is essential before the plastic surgery. During the meeting, the doctor discusses the course of the procedure, the possible results, and potential postoperative complications with the patient. It is very important to inform the doctor about all medications taken, both prescription and over-the-counter, including any drugs used. On the day of the surgery, after admission to the clinic, the plastic surgeon conducts a conversation with the patient and ultimately decides whether to perform the procedure. On the day of the surgery, eating or drinking is not allowed for six hours before the operation. Patients who smoke should quit nicotine six weeks before the surgery, as it reduces the amount of oxygen in the blood and can significantly increase the risk of postoperative complications.
Do scars remain after breast reduction?
Yes, however, they are planned in such a way as to be as inconspicuous as possible. Over time, they fade and become barely noticeable. Using the recommended products and proper care significantly improves their appearance.
Does breast reduction improve symmetry?
Yes. The procedure allows for equalizing the size and shape of the breasts, resulting in a harmonious, natural effect.
Is the procedure safe?
Breast reduction is one of the most commonly performed procedures in plastic surgery. With proper qualification and an experienced team, it is a safe and predictable procedure.
Is the result of the surgery permanent?
Yes. The removed tissue does not regrow. However, fluctuations in body weight, pregnancy, or hormonal changes may affect the appearance of the breasts in the future.
